A Sign From Nature Poem by Francis Duggan

A Sign From Nature



When you hear the blackbird singing in the warmth of a Summer's day
It is a sign from Nature that rain is on the way
Since blackbirds are natural Spring songsters in Summer their songs tell of rain
From listening to Nature's wildborn creatures weather insights we do gain
Birds can be Nature's weather forecasters of such instances quite a few
But to that you may even say tell us something that is new
Of Nature's many wonders we do become aware
But she has many secrets that with us she'll never share
The blackbird one of Nature's leading songsters in the green Season of Spring
But before rain in Summer he too is known to sing
One of Nature's many weather forecasters of weather change birds know
At the ways of our Earth Mother our wonder only grow
When in the warmth of a Summer's day the blackbird's song you hear
It is a sign from Nature that rain is very near.
